This Methode Champenois rosé, made up of about two-thirds Pinot Noir and one-third Chardonnay from Adelsheim's estate vineyards, is a wine I look forward to trying every year. Aged for four years en tirage and disgorged last February, this wine shows the perfect balance of richness and freshness. What an incredible domestic sparkling wine this is!
Adelsheim (pronounced Addels-Heim) was founded in 1971 by David and Ginny Adelsheim with one pursuit: to create world-class wines in the undiscovered wine region that would later become Chehalem Mountains AVA, a venerable subregion of Oregon's famous Willamette Valley. One of the original, most influential, and most important producers of the region, Adelsheim has a long track record of producing some of the finest Burgundian-style Pinot Noirs and Chardonnays produced domestically.
